Calgary Flames 2 Anaheim Ducks 3
Welp, the winning streak is over at 4 games and the Ducks did what they do best: beat the Flames in Anaheim. Calgary mounted a 3rd period comeback, but that was sniffed out by a Ryan Getzlaf goal shortly after the Flames tied the game at 2-2. Tidbits
-3rd Still Good: Calgary scored another third period goal last night, upping their total in the final frame to 29 goals on the season. Maybe score some more early and this won't be an issue?
-Grrrrr...Geztlaf: Ryan Getzlaf scored the game winning goal last night and it was also his 250th goal of his career. Hooray, good for you Getzlaf.
-Janko Makes The Score Sheet: Mark Jankowski scored the game tying goal on a beautiful wrist shot. Seems odd that it would be his first of the season, but it was.
